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ies
Step 1: Prepare Dry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, whisk together 2 cups of all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on baking soda, 1 teaspoon baking powder, and a pinch of salt until evenly combined. This step is essential for a uniform cookie texture, so set the bowl aside while you work on the wet ingredients.
Step 2: Cream Butters and Sugars
Using a stand mixer or a large mixing bowl, cream ½ cup of room-temperature unsalted butter with ½ cup granulated sugar and ½ cup brown sugar. Beat for 2-3 minutes until the mixture is fluffy and light in color. This process incorporates air, ensuring your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ies turn out soft and chewy.
Step 3: Incorporate Wet Ingredients
Add 1 egg, ½ cup of creamy peanut butter, ½ cup of sourdough discard, and 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ract to the creamed butter and sugars. Mix on medium speed until thoroughly combined, scraping down the sides of the bowl as needed to ensure no pockets of ingredients remain, creating a smooth cookie dough base.
Step 4: Combine Dry and Wet Mixtures
Gradually incorporate the dry ingredient mixture into the wet mixture, mixing on low speed until just combined and no flour streaks remain. This helps maintain the texture and ensures your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ies are consistent throughout. Be careful not to overmix, which could lead to tough cookies.
Step 5: Chill the Dough
Wrap the cookie dough in pl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ight. Chilling is crucial for maintaining the shape of your cookies during baking, preventing them from spreading too much. This also enhances the flavor as the ingredients meld together beautifully.
Step 6: Preheat and Prepare Baking Sheet
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) approximately 15 minutes before baking. While it heats, line a ba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cookie removal. This step ensures your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ies bake evenly and come off the tray without sticking.
Step 7: Shape Cookies
Once chilled, scoop tablespoon-sized balls of dough and roll them in granulated sugar until coated. Place them 2 inches apart on the prepared baking sheet, as they will spread slightly during baking. This spacing prevents them from merging and helps achieve that ideal cookie shape.
Step 8: Bake the Cookies
Bake the cookies in your preheated oven for 9-11 minutes, or until they are slightly cracked and the bottoms are golden brown. The edges should look set while the center remains soft, which is perfect for achieving that chewy texture characteristic of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ies.
Step 9: Add Hershey’s Kisses
Immediately after removing the cookies from the oven, gently press a Hershey’s Kiss into the center of each warm cookie. This melting chocolate adds that signature touch, transforming your cookies into delightful treats. Allow them to cool slightly on the baking sheet for a few minutes.
Step 10: Cool and Serve
Transfer the cookies to a wire rack to cool completely. Once they have cooled enough to handle, they are ready to be enjoyed! These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ies make a perfect pairing with a glass of cold milk or warm coffee for that delightful treat.

How to Store and Freeze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ies
Room Temperature: Store cooled c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5-7 days to maintain freshness.
Fridge: If you prefer your cookies chilled, they can be kept in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week; just allow them to come to room temperature before enjoying.
Freezer: Freeze cookie dough balls for up to two months. To bake, simply thaw in the fridge overnight before baking for a warm treat anytime.
Reheating: Warm cookies in the microwave for 10-15 seconds for that fresh-out-of-the-oven taste, perfect for savoring with a glass of milk!
Expert Tips for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ies
-
Chill the Dough: Ensure you refrigerate the dough for at least 4 hours. This step prevents spreading and enhances the flavors in your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ies.
-
Use Processed Peanut Butter: Opt for brands like Jiff or Skippy for the best texture. Natural peanut butter can alter the consistency, making cookies less chewy.
-
Check Baking Leaveners: Always verify that your baking soda and baking powder are fresh to achieve the perfect rise in your cookies. Stale leaveners can lead to dense cookies.
-
Monitor Baking Time: Every oven is slightly different. Keep an eye on your cookies during the last few minutes of baking to avoid overcooking; a light golden bottom is ideal.
-
Experiment with Toppings: While Hershey’s Kisses are classic, feel free to try Caramel Kisses or mini peanut butter cups. Versatile toppings can create fun variations of your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ossoms!

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ies Recipe FAQs
How should I select the right sourdough discard?
Absolutely! When choosing sourdough discard, it’s best to use it within a week of feeding to ensure optimal flavor. Look for discard that has a pleasant tangy aroma and no signs of discoloration. Discard that is too old or has dark spots all over may not yield the best results in your cookies.
What’s the best way to store leftover cookies?
You can store your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for 5-7 days. Make sure the cookies have completely cooled before sealing them to retain their chewy texture. For longer storage, you can refrigerate them for up to a week.
Can I freeze the cookie dough?
Very much so! To freeze your cookie dough balls, scoop and shape them as instructed, then lay them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Freeze until solid, then transfer the cookie dough balls to a freezer-safe bag or container. They can be stored for up to 2 months. When ready to bake, just thaw the dough in the fridge overnight and bake as usual.
I find my cookies are flattening out too much after baking. What could be wrong?
This can happen if the dough isn’t chilled long enough, leading to cookies that spread too much. Ensure you are chilling the dough for at least 4 hours, or ideally overnight. Additionally, check that your leavening agents (baking soda and powder) are fresh, as stale ingredients can affect texture.
Are these cookies suitable for people with nut allergies?
Certainly! If you need a nut-free version of the Sourdough Peanut Butter Blossom Cookies, simply substitute the peanut butter with sunflower seed butter. This not only works well in the recipe but also maintains the rich, creamy taste we love in cookies, ensuring everyone can enjoy a tasty treat!
What types of toppings can I use besides Hershey’s Kisses?
You can get creative with your toppings! I often recommend trying Caramel Kisses, white chocolate Hugs, or even mini peanut butter cups for a delightful twist. Experimenting with colored sugar before baking can also add a festive touch for holiday gatherings.
